To the moon; pupil; or a people
Aluna has multiple potential origins. In Spanish, it is often interpreted as a contraction of 'a la luna' (to the moon). In the Kogi language of Colombia, it refers to a spiritual concept of the mind or 'the Great Mother' who created the world. It also appears as a rare variant of the Hawaiian name Alana.
